No Image

Как записать макрос в ворде 2010

СОДЕРЖАНИЕ
401 просмотров
16 декабря 2019

Макрос — это набор определенных действий, команд и/или инструкций, которые сгруппированы в одну целостную команду, обеспечивающую автоматическое выполнение той или иной задачи. Если вы активный пользователь MS Word, вы тоже можете автоматизировать часто выполняемые задачи, создав для них соответствующие макросы.

Именно о том, как включить макросы в Ворд, как их создавать и использовать для упрощения, ускорения рабочего процесса и пойдет речь в этой статье. И все же, для начала не лишним будет более подробно разобраться в том, зачем вообще они нужны.

Области использования макросов:

    1. Ускорение часто выполняемых операций. В числе таковых форматирование и редактирование.

2. Объединение нескольких команд в целостное действие “от и до”. Например, с помощью макроса можно вставить таблицу заданного размера с необходимым количеством строк и столбцов.

3. Упрощение доступа к некоторым параметрам и инструментам, расположенным в различных диалоговых окнах программы.

4. Автоматизация сложных последовательностей действий.

Последовательность макросов может быть записана или создана с нуля путем введения кода в редактор Visual Basic на одноименном языке программирования.

Включение макросов

По умолчанию макросы доступны не во всех версиях MS Word, точнее, они просто не включены. Чтобы активировать их необходимо включить средства разработчика. После этого на панели управления программы появится вкладка “Разработчик”. О том, как это сделать, читайте ниже.

Примечание: В версиях программы, в которых макросы доступны изначально (например, Ворд 2016), средства для работы с ними находятся во вкладке “Вид” в группе “Макросы”.

1. Откройте меню “Файл” (кнопка “Microsoft Office” ранее).

2. Выберите пункт “Параметры” (ранее “Параметры Word”).

3. Откройте в окне “Параметры” категорию “Основные” и перейдите в группе “Основные параметры работы”.

4. Установите галочку напротив пункта “Показывать вкладку “Разработчик” на ленте”.

5. На панели управления появится вкладка “Разработчик”, в которой и будет находиться пункт “Макросы”.

Запись макросов

1. Во вкладке “Разработчик” или, в зависимости от используемой версии Ворда, во вкладке “Вид”, нажмите кнопку “Макросы” и выберите пункт “Запись макроса”.

2. Задайте имя для создаваемого макроса.

Примечание: Если вы, создавая новый макрос, даете ему точно такое же имя, как у встроенного в программу, действия, записанные вами в новый макрос, будут выполняться взамен стандартным. Для просмотра макросов, доступных в MS Word по умолчанию, в меню кнопки “Макросы” выберите “Команды Word”.

3. В пункте “Макрос доступен для” выберите то, для чего он будет доступен: шаблон или документ, в который его следует сохранить.

    Совет: Если вы хотите, чтобы создаваемый макрос был доступен во всех документах, с которыми вы работаете в дальнейшем, выберите параметр “Normal.dotm”.

4. В поле “Описание” введите описание для создаваемого макроса.

5. Выполните одно из действий, указанных ниже:

  • Начните запись — чтобы приступить к началу записи макроса, не связывая его при этом с кнопкой на панели управления или комбинацией клавиш, нажмите “ОК”.
  • Создайте кнопку — чтобы связать создаваемый макрос с кнопкой, расположенной на панели управления, выполните следующее:
    1. Нажмите “кнопке”;
        • Выберите документ или документы, в которых требуется добавить создаваемый макрос на панель быстрого доступа (раздел “Настройка панели быстрого доступа”);

        Совет: Чтобы создаваемый макрос был доступен для всех документов, выберите параметр “Normal.dotm”.

      В окне “Макрос из” (ранее “Выбрать команды из”) выберите макрос, который следует записать, нажмите “Добавить”.

        • Если вы хотите настроить эту кнопку, нажмите “Изменить”;
        • Выберите подходящий символ для создаваемой кнопки в поле “Символ”;
        • Введите имя макроса, которое будет отображаться в дальнейшем в поле “Отображаемое имя”;
        • Для начала записи макроса дважды кликните по кнопке “ОК”.

      Символ, который вы выбрали, будет отображаться на панели быстрого доступа. При наведении указателя курсора на этот символ, будет отображаться его имя.

    2. Назначьте сочетание клавиш — Для того, чтобы назначить комбинацию клавиш для создаваемого макроса, выполните следующие действия:
      1. Кликните по кнопке “Клавишами” (ранее “Клавиатура”);
          • В разделе “Команды” выберите макрос, который необходимо записать;

          • В разделе “Новое сочетание клавиш” введите любую удобную для вас комбинацию, после чего нажмите кнопку “Назначить”;

          • Для начала записи макроса нажмите “Закрыть”.

        6. Выполните поочередно все те действия, которые необходимо включить в макрос.

        Примечание: Во время записи макроса нельзя использовать мышь для выделения текста, а вот для выбора команд и параметров нужно использовать именно ее. При необходимости, выделить текст можно с помощью клавиатуры.

        7. Для остановки записи макроса нажмите “Остановить запись”, эта команда расположена в меню кнопки “Макросы” на панели управления.

        Изменение комбинаций клавиш для макроса

        1. Откройте окно “Параметры” (меню “Файл” или кнопка “MS Office”).

        2. Выберите пункт “Настройка”.

        3. Нажмите на кнопку “Настройка”, расположенную рядом с полем “Сочетание клавиш”.

        4. В разделе “Категории” выберите “Макросы”.

        5. В открывшемся списке выберите макрос, который необходимо изменить.

        6. Кликните по полю “Новое сочетание клавиш” и нажмите клавиши или комбинацию клавиш, которые вы хотите назначить для конкретного макроса.

        7. Убедитесь, что назначенное вами сочетание клавиш не используется для выполнения другой задачи (поле “Текущее сочетание”).

        8. В разделе “Сохранить изменения” выберите подходящий вариант (место) для сохранения места, где макрос будет запускаться.

          Совет: Если вы хотите, чтобы макрос был доступен к использованию во всех документах, выберите параметр “Normal.dotm”.

        9. Нажмите “Закрыть”.

        Запуск макроса

        1. Нажмите на кнопку “Макросы” (вкладка “Вид” или “Разработчик”, в зависимости от используемой версии программы).

        2. Выберите макрос, который хотите запустить (список “Имя макроса”).

        3. Нажмите “Выполнить”.

        Создание нового макроса

        1. Нажмите кнопку “Макросы”.

        2. Задайте имя для нового макроса в соответствующем поле.

        3. В разделе “Макросы из” выберите шаблон или документ, для которого будет сохранен создаваемый макрос.

          Совет: Если вы хотите, чтобы макрос стал доступен во всех документах, выберите параметр “Normal.dotm”.

        4. Нажмите “Создать”. Будет открыт редактор Visual Basic, в котором и можно будет создать новый макрос на языке Visual Basic.

        На этом все, теперь вы знаете, что такое макросы в MS Word, зачем они нужны, как их создавать и как с ними работать. Надеемся, информация из этой статьи будет полезной для вас и действительно поможет упростить, ускорить работу со столь продвинутой офисной программой.

        Отблагодарите автора, поделитесь статьей в социальных сетях.

        Запись макроса – это возможность создания макроса без написания кода вручную. Вообще говоря, записанный макрос можно использовать без изменений, но также можно добавить в него свой код на языке Visual Basic for Applications (VBA).

        *** Здесь рассматривается запись макроса в Word 2010. В версиях Word, в которых нет ленты, записать макрос можно из меню Сервис.

        Чтобы начать запись, нужно на ленте на вкладке Разработчик щелкнуть на кнопке Запись макроса:


        В появившемся диалоговом окне можно задать имя макроса, назначить кнопку или сочетание клавиш для его запуска, выбрать место хранения и добавить описание.


        По умолчанию макрос сохраняется в шаблон Normal.dotm, т.е. он будет доступен во всех документах Word с поддержкой макросов (расширение файла .docm).

        Если выбрать Назначить макросклавишам, можно назначить для макроса сочетание клавиш клавиатуры. Когда курсор находится в поле Новое сочетание клавиш, нажмите клавиши, которые вы хотите использовать для запуска нового макроса, например, Ctrl+ю. Если появится сообщение Текущее назначение: [нет], значит введенное вами сочетание клавиш свободно, и его можно использовать без ограничений.

        В режиме записи макроса

        Вы можете печатать текст, вставлять содержимое буфера обмена, использовать команды на вкладках. Мышью можно выбирать команды на вкладках, но нельзя щелкать в тексте документа и выделять, поэтому перемещаться по тексту и выделять нужно с помощью клавиатуры, например, чтобы выделить все символы справа от курсора до следующего слова , нажмите Shift+Ctrl+стрелка вправо, а до конца строки – Shift+End.

        На вкладке Разработчик вместо кнопки Запись макроса вы видите кнопку Остановить запись, на которой нужно щелкнуть, когда вы выполните все нужные действия.

        Вот какие действия можно выполнить во время записи макроса, который будет вставлять в текст словоПримечание с увеличенным размером шрифта, выделенное курсивом:

        1. Напечатать слово Примечание и, чтобы выделить его, нажать Shift+Ctrl+стрелка влево
        2. На вкладке Главная щелкнуть на кнопке Курсив (К ) и выбрать размер шрифта 14
        3. Нажать клавишу со стрелкой вправо, чтобы снять выделение со слова Примечание, и вернуться к исходным настройкам шрифта, т.е. еще раз щелкнуть на кнопке Курсив (К) и выбрать размер шрифта 12
        4. Теперь можно еще добавить пробел. Этот и последующие символы будут отображаться обычным шрифтом, без курсива и с размером 12.

        Использование записанного макроса

        Выполнение макроса

        Записанный макрос можно быстро запускать с помощью сочетания клавиш клавиатуры.

        Кстати, чтобы назначить или изменить сочетание клавиш для готового макроса:

        1. Откройте настройки ленты (Файл-Параметры-Настройка ленты) и на правой панели внизу около Сочетания клавиш щелкните на Настройка.
        2. Прокрутите вниз список в поле Категории и выберите Макросы
        3. В поле Макросы (справа) выделите нужный макрос и задайте для него Новое сочетание клавиш

        Кроме того, можно на вкладке Разработчик щелкнуть на кнопке Макрос, выделить имя нужного макроса в списке и щелкнуть на кнопке Выполнить, как показано на рисунке:

        Использование и изменение записанного кода

        Запись макроса позволяет многократно повторять действия, выполненные во время записи. Но, если вас интересует написание своих макросов, использование кода, созданного во время записи, также упрощает программирование некоторых задач и помогает научиться программировать на языке Visual Basic.

        На ленте на вкладке Разработчик щелкните на кнопке Visual Basic или нажмите Alt+F11, чтобы открыть среду разработки Visual Basic for Applications.

        Если макрос сохранен в шаблон Normal.dotm, его код можно посмотреть в файле NewMacros (Новые макросы), который находится в папке Modules (Модули) шаблона Normal .


        Конечно, написание своего кода потребует больше времени, чем просто запись макроса с помощью команд вкладки Разработчик. Но для некоторых задач может быть достаточно только немного изменить записанный макрос.

        А вы знали, что часто повторяемые действия в текстовом редакторе Word последних версий (2007, 2010, 2013, 2016) можно автоматизировать? Достигается это путем создания макросов в "Ворде". Что это, как их сделать, включить/отключить, как открыть файл с такими элементами, мы обязательно разберем далее.

        Что это — макросы в "Ворде"?

        Макрос — это комплекс инструкций, группируемых в единую команду для автоматического выполнения того или иного задания. Пишутся они на языке Visual Basic в редакторе с одноименным названием.

        Чаще всего макросы применяются пользователем для:

        • Ускорения наиболее востребованных действий форматирования, редактирования.
        • Объединения нескольких команд в одну. Как пример — создание таблицы с определенным числом столбцов, строк, стилем границ.
        • Облегчения доступа к параметрам, находящимся в диалоговых окнах.
        • Автоматизации процесса обработки последовательных сложных операций.

        Таким образом, макросы в "Ворде" превращают несколько задач в одно действие. Чтобы его осуществить, необходимо набрать комбинацию клавиш или нажать на кнопку панели быстрого доступа.

        Word 2010-2016: запись макроса, запускающегося кнопкой

        Разберем, как создать макрос в "Ворде" этого типа:

        1. Зайдите в "Вид", выберите "Макрос" — "Создать. ".
        2. Придумайте имя для этого комплекса команд.
        3. Если вы хотите использовать его для всех файлов, то обязательно выберите доступность "Для всех документов".
        4. Кликните на назначение "По кнопке".
        5. В следующем окне кликните на новый макрос. Его наименование будет начинаться с Normal — NewMacros, после чего будет следовать имя, которым вы его обозначили.
        6. Далее — щелчок на "Добавить", а затем на "Изменить".
        7. Из предложенной палитры выберите значок для своего макроса в "Ворде".
        8. Теперь самая важная часть: запись шагов. Для каждого нужно выбрать команду или нажать определенную клавишу. Текст необходимо выделять с помощью клавиатуры. Система будет записывать все шаги, что вы сделаете, — нажатия клавиш, действия мышью.
        9. Когда вы завершите задуманное, закончите запись: зайдя в раздел "Макросы", выберите "Остановить. "

        Вы увидите, что на панели быстрого доступа появилась кнопка созданной вами команды. Нажав на нее, вы автоматически выполните записанную последовательность действий.

        Word 2010-2016: запись макроса, запускающегося комбинацией клавиш

        Теперь разберем, как создать макрос в "Ворде", который активируется нажатием сочетания кнопок:

        1. Зайдите в "Вид", найдите "Макросы". Далее — "Записать. "
        2. Введите его имя. Не забудьте указать, если это нужно, что макрос доступен для всех документов.
        3. Выберете значок доступности по клавиатуре.
        4. В поле "Новое сочетание. " введите определенную комбинацию клавиш, которая будет запускать в действие макрос. Если она будет совпадать с другой стандартной командой, то нужно придумать иное сочетание.
        5. Кликните на "Назначить".
        6. Теперь запись шагов для макроса: для каждого из них выставляйте определенную команду, щелчок мышкой. Все действия будут сохраняться системой.
        7. Когда все будет готово, зайдите в "Макросы" (меню "Вид") и остановите запись.

        Теперь установленным сочетанием клавиш вы можете активировать созданный комплекс команд.

        Word 2007: начало создания макроса

        Теперь расскажем, как сделать макрос в "Ворде 2007". Процесс немного отличается от того, что представлен для поздних версий этого текстового редактора.

        Первым делом вам нужно активировать вкладку разработчика:

        1. Кликните на кнопку Microsoft Office (круглую, с логотипом компании).
        2. Выберите "Параметры "Ворда"".
        3. В "Основных параметрах. " сделайте активным пункт "Показывать "Разработчик" на ленте".

        Теперь переходим непосредственно к созданию комплекса команд:

        1. Зайдите на появившуюся вкладку "Разработчик". В "Коде" выберите "Запись макроса".
        2. В "Имя. " введите название. Будьте внимательны: если оно будет совпадать с наименованием стандартного макроса, то новая запись заменит его. Поэтому для проверки в "Макросах" группы "Код" найдите "Команды Word" и убедитесь, что придуманное имя не совпадает с там присутствующими.
        3. В "Макрос доступен. " выберите, где его можно применять. Если для всех файлов, то остановитесь на Normal.dotm.
        4. Введите описание.

        Word 2007: три варианта записи макроса

        Далее вы можете пойти тремя путями.

        Запись без привязки. Вы пишете макрос, не связывая его ни с кнопкой, ни с сочетанием клавиш. Для этого достаточно нажать на ОК.

        Привязка макроса к кнопке. Тут следует пойти таким путем:

        1. Щелкните на "По кнопке".
        2. В "Настройки панели быстрого доступа" выберите все документы или отдельный файл, где можно применять этот макрос.
        3. В окне "Выбрать команды" нажмите на нужный макрос. Затем — щелчок на "Добавить".
        4. Для настройки кликните на "Изменить".
        5. В "Символе" выберите значок для кнопки.
        6. "Отображаемое имя" — наименование макроса.
        7. Два раза кликните на ОК, чтобы начать запись.

        Привязка макроса к сочетанию клавиш. Здесь следующий путь:

        1. Остановитесь на "Клавиатуре".
        2. В "Командах" найдите макрос, который вы собрались записать.
        3. В "Новом сочетании клавиш" введите придуманную комбинацию. Клик на "Назначить".
        4. Щелкните на "Закрыть", чтобы начать запись.

        Далее путь становится единым для всех вариантов:

        1. Выполните последовательность действий, которую нужно включить в макрос.
        2. Завершить процесс можно выбором "Остановить запись" во вкладке "Код".

        Открытие файлов с макросами

        Документы, поддерживающие макросы, имеют расширение .docm. Трудности с ними иногда возникают на моменте запуска — текстовой редактор выдает ошибку. Разберем, как открыть "Ворд" с макросами:

        • Два раза щелкните на данный документ. Система сама выберет программу на вашем ПК, способную его открыть.
        • При неудаче измените расширение на .doc, .docx.
        • В случае неудовлетворительного результата воспользуйтесь программами:
        • Word 2007, распознающий Open XML.
        • "Ворд" 2010.
        • Приложение FileViewPro.

        Включение макросов

        Как включить макросы в "Ворде"? Есть три варианта.

        При появлении панели сообщений. Как только вы открываете файл с макросами, перед вами на экране выходит желтое окошко с щитом и просьбой включить данный комплекс команд. Только если вы уверены в надежности источника документа, нажмите на панели "Включить содержимое".

        С помощью представления Backstage. При открытии файла с макросами сделайте следующее:

        1. Кликните на "Файл".
        2. В "Предупреждении системы безопасности" нажмите на пункт "Включить содержимое".
        3. В данном разделе сделайте активным "Всегда включать. " Это превратит документ в надежный.

        Включение на время открытия документа. Можно сделать макросы активными только на период работы с определенным файлом. Когда вы его уже закроете и запустите заново, их снова придется включать. Для такого варианта следующий алгоритм:

        1. Откройте вкладку с названием "Файл".
        2. В "Предупреждении системы безопасности" нажмите на "Включить содержимое".
        3. Перейдете в "Доп. параметры".
        4. В "Параметрах безопасности. " выберите "Включить лишь для этого сеанса" в отношении каждого из имеющихся в документе макросов.
        5. Подтвердите нажатием ОК.

        Отключение макросов

        Напоследок разберем, как убрать макросы в "Ворде":

        1. Во вкладке "Файл" перейдите на "Параметры".
        2. В "Центре управления. " выберите "Параметры центра. "
        3. Щелкните на "Параметры макросов".
        4. Выберите, что вам нужно:
          • Отключить все без уведомления (как макросы, так и предупреждения об опасности/безопасности).
          • Отключить все с уведомлением (убираются только макросы, уведомления о безопасности остаются).
          • Отключить все, кроме макросов с цифровой подписью (отображаются только макросы издателя, которому выражено доверие, — на их включение нужно согласиться в уведомлении при открытии файла).
          • Подтвердите выбор нажатием на ОК.

          Создание макросов имеет свои особенности в различных версиях текстового редактора "Ворд". А при открытии файла с данной группой команд в данной программе вы можете выбрать, включать или не активировать их.

          Комментировать
          401 просмотров
          Комментариев нет, будьте первым кто его оставит

          Это интересно
          No Image Компьютеры
          0 комментариев
          No Image Компьютеры
          0 комментариев
          No Image Компьютеры
          0 комментариев
          No Image Компьютеры
          0 комментариев